This month, with Christmas here, we are and have given and
helped with the following Programs.  On Dec. 1, 2006 and 2nd,
Auxiliary Volunteers went to the VAMC Center inMartinsburg, WV .
We all wrapped  Christmas gifts for our veterans.  They took
$100.00 in gifts, and  Also, on Saturday Dec. 2, 2006
after all the gifts were wrapped, we served refreshments for all our
veterans.On this day, our Ladies  Auxiliary were presented with a
"Certificate of Appreciation" for the 60 years that the Auxiliary has
been wrapping gifts.

On Dec 6, 2006, our Ladies Auxiliary attended a night of Live
Entertainment, performed by Chance Bazzano,
1st Vice Commander, and Service Officer for 2007, from Post #21,
during  the course of the evening, we served refreshments to all
the Veterans, while Chance played and sang, and also offered
Karaoke to our veterans in the cafeteria.

On Dec. 10th, 2006 our Auxiliary members baked cupcakes and
cookies and donated $200.00 to the Children's Christmas Party
hosted at
American Legion Post 21.

On Dec. 20, 2006, the
S.A.L. Donated money to help the Ladies buy gifts for
87 Ladies and 56 Men at the Evergreen Rehab Facility.  
Dorothy Herring and Bridget Ragens will go on a Shopping
Spree to buy Gifts for every one of them.    Santa Claus will give
everyone at the Nursing Home a gift, wrapped by The Ladies.  
Refreshments will be served as well.   Donnie Herring will play
music and Carols were sung to all the residents.  As a note of
Interest, There are 10 different Veterans From all different Eras of
War Times Living at this Home as inpatients.  
The Auxiliary has already donated $500.00 towards the
Christmas baskets for the patients residing there.
